  • There are a lot of options in the station and this was one of the izakaya’s that I had been recommended. Would recommend getting a mix of cold and hot dishes as the hot dishes take some time to arrive as opposed to the cold dishes which come relatively quickly. Drinks are cheap too so you can have a nice quick drink and tapas style nibbles
